How to invest in blockchain technology

Blockchain technology has evolved significantly since Bitcoin’s emergence in 2009, becoming a crucial element in finance, supply chains, and digital ecosystems. Investing in blockchain requires understanding the technology and various investment options.

Understanding Blockchain Investment

Investing in blockchain is a strategic process demanding careful consideration. It’s essential to grasp the technology and the different investment forms it offers, from cryptocurrencies to blockchain stocks and ETFs.

Ways to Invest in Blockchain

Several avenues exist for investing in blockchain:

  • Blockchain Stocks: Many companies are leveraging blockchain technology, offering investment opportunities.
  • Cryptocurrencies: Investing in c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in and Ethereum is a direct way to participate in the blockchain ecosystem.
  • Blockchain ETFs: ETFs provide diversified exposure to companies involved in blockchain technology.
  • Tech Stocks: Some tech companies are heavily involved in blockchain development.
  • Startups: Investing in blockchain startups can offer high-growth potential.

Due Diligence is Key

Before investing, research the technology, industry, and investment options. Consult credible sources like whitepapers, research reports, and trustworthy news outlets.

Blockchain Stocks: A Closer Look

Investing in blockchain stocks allows you to participate in the growth of companies actively utilizing or developing blockchain solutions. These companies can range from software developers creating blockchain platforms to financial institutions integrating blockchain for secure transactions. When evaluating blockchain stocks, consider the following:

  • Company’s Core Business: Is blockchain a core component of their business, or is it a secondary initiative?
  • Blockchain Applications: What specific problems is the company solving with blockchain? Are these applications practical and scalable?
  • Financial Health: Assess the company’s overall financial stability and growth potential.
  • Competitive Landscape: Analyze the company’s position within the blockchain industry and its competitors.

Cryptocurrency Investing: Navigating the Volatility

Cryptocurrencies are a direct representation of blockchain technology. However, the cryptocurrency market is known for its volatility. Before investing in cryptocurrencies, understand the risks and potential rewards:

  • Research Different Cryptocurrencies: Don’t just invest in the most popular coins. Understand the underlying technology, purpose, and community behind each cryptocurrency.
  • Diversify Your Portfolio: Spread your investments across multiple cryptocurrencies to mitigate risk.
  • Use Reputable Exchanges: Choose secure and well-established cryptocurrency exchanges for buying and selling.
  • Understand Wallet Security: Learn how to securely store your cryptocurrencies in a digital wallet.
  • Be Prepared for Volatility: The value of cryptocurrencies can fluctuate dramatically. Be prepared for potential losses.

Blockchain ETFs: Diversified Exposure

Blockchain ETFs offer a diversified way to invest in the blockchain industry. These ETFs typically hold a basket of stocks of companies involved in blockchain technology, spreading your risk across multiple companies. Consider the following when choosing a blockchain ETF:

  • Holdings: Review the ETF’s holdings to understand which companies it invests in.
  • Expense Ratio: Compare the expense ratios of different ETFs.
  • Tracking Error: Assess how closely the ETF tracks its underlying index.
  • Liquidity: Ensure the ETF has sufficient trading volume.
